Syndrome analysis

There is a relationship of mutual support and restraint between the internal organs. Therefore, under pathological conditions, local lesions in the lungs will inevitably affect other organs and the whole body. Hence, there is a saying that "the evil spreads and invades the five internal organs". Pulmonary tuberculosis is most closely related to the spleen and kidneys. The spleen is the mother of the lungs. If the lungs are weak, the spleen will be deprived of its spleen energy to nourish itself, and the spleen will also be weak. If the spleen is weak and cannot transform water and grain into essence and transport it to nourish the lungs, the lung deficiency will be more serious. They are mutually causal and will eventually lead to lung and spleen diseases, with symptoms such as fatigue, poor appetite, loose stools, chills, and tiredness. The kidney is the child of the lung. When the lung is weak, the kidney loses its source of nourishment, or when the kidney is weak, the fire of the kidney burns the metal, and the son steals the mother's qi, causing the lung qi to be further exhausted and unable to nourish the kidney, eventually leading to deficiency of both lung and kidney, deficiency of kidney yin, hyperactivity of the fire of the kidney, and disturbance of the seminal chamber, which will cause nocturnal emission, and women will have irregular menstruation and other symptoms of kidney deficiency.

If the lung is weak and cannot control the liver, and the kidney is weak and cannot nourish the liver, the liver fire will be excessively strong and go against the flow and insult the lungs, and symptoms such as impatience, anger, and pain in the ribs may be seen. If the lung is weak and the heart fire is suppressed, or the kidney is weak and the water cannot support the fire, it may also be accompanied by symptoms such as insomnia, night sweats, bone steaming and tuberculosis. If the disease is prolonged and severe, it may develop into disease involving the lungs, spleen, and kidneys. It may be due to lung disease and kidney disease, causing kidney deficiency and inability to absorb air, or due to spleen deficiency and kidney disease, causing the spleen to be unable to transform essence to nourish the kidney. From acquired to congenital, even lung deficiency may be unable to assist the heart in regulating blood circulation, leading to qi deficiency and blood stasis, and symptoms such as shortness of breath, wheezing, palpitations, cyanosis of the lips, cold limbs, edema, etc., which is the occurrence of cor pulmonale.

This syndrome occurs in patients with deficiency of the lung, spleen, and kidney. It develops from the depletion of qi and yin and is seen in the late stage of severe pulmonary tuberculosis.

To sum up: pulmonary tuberculosis is caused by Yin deficiency first, which can then lead to deficiency of both Qi and Yin, or deficiency of both Yin and Yang. In terms of organ differentiation, at the onset of the disease, it is a deficiency of lung yin, followed by simultaneous disease of the lungs and spleen, with both qi and yin damaged. In the later stages, the lungs, spleen, and kidneys are deficient, with yin damaging both yang, leading to deficiency of both yin and yang, and severe symptoms of damage to the functions of the heart, liver, and organs.
